Howard Hughes

United States

In 1938 Howard Hughes flew around the world in 3 days, 19 hours, and 17 minutes, earning a ticker-tape parade in New York. He produced landmark films like Scarface 1932 and Hell's Angels 1930. Later in life he became a reclusive billionaire, dying of kidney failure in 1976.
